Problem:
I am currently trying to analyse an array of solar panels to calculate the drag and lift forces. The array has 100 x 100 solar panels, with each solar panel's dimension as 2000mm x 1000mm x 40mm. The panels are mounted in a landscape format with 5 deg tilt from the ground facing south. Solar panels have zero ground clearance. As the array is very big, it is very difficult to mesh the whole domain.

Question:
1. Is it possible to create a mesh for only one solar panel and then create the 100 x 100 array using the translational periodic feature in fluent?
2. The subsequent rows of solar panels will experience sheltering from the row in front leading to a lower wind load. Will the sheltering effect be captured by the periodic mesh?

2. The sheltering effect can be captured; but using the periodic BC you will end up with the solution to an infinite array (not a 100x100 array).

1. Nothing to do with periodic BC's but you can translate the mesh and merge them together and recursively build a mesh for a 100x100 array.
